Hull midfielder Nathan Doyle has refused to rule out making a permanent switch to Barnsley in the New Year.
The 22-year-old is on loan at Oakwell and has been there since mid-September but his loan will come to an end on December 20th although he has not ruled out a return to South Yorkshire. Doyle's first team opportunities have been limited to just a Carling Cup run out for the Tigers this season and he has enjoyed the day to day training and then playing with Barnsley.
He told the club's website: "I've definitely got to go back on December 20 because it's an emergency loan but we'll have to wait and see what happens in January to see how I progress.
"It's been nice training all week and playing at the end of it as opposed to not knowing whether you're involved but I've got to keep my head down, work hard and see what happens with Hull and Barnsley.
"It's been a good time on the field with winning games and moving up the table and competing with top teams in the division."
